📖 Manual Coverage
Systems Covered
Engine Mechanical:
Full disassembly, assembly, inspection, repair, and adjustment of engine components including cylinders, pistons, crankshaft, camshafts, valves, timing system, and cooling system.
Fuel System:
Carburetor inspection, cleaning, adjustment, and repair; fuel pump operation and testing; fuel tank and lines maintenance.
Ignition System:
Spark plug diagnosis, ignition coil testing, CDI unit inspection, timing adjustment procedures.
Transmission System:
Gearbox disassembly, inspection, reassembly, and adjustment; clutch operation, maintenance, and adjustment; transmission fluid specifications and change intervals.
Chassis And Suspension:
Front fork overhaul, rear shock absorber inspection and replacement, swingarm maintenance, steering head bearing service, wheel bearing replacement.
Braking System:
Brake caliper inspection and service, brake pad replacement, brake fluid bleeding and replacement, master cylinder inspection, brake line maintenance.
Electrical System:
Wiring diagrams, battery testing and maintenance, charging system diagnosis (stator, regulator/rectifier), starter motor operation, lighting system troubleshooting, fuse and relay identification.
Exhaust System:
Exhaust pipe and muffler inspection, gasket replacement, and tightening specifications.
Cooling System:
Radiator inspection and cleaning, coolant specifications and capacity, thermostat operation (if applicable, though GV125 is typically air-cooled, this covers general principles).
